Output 8c566eb2fdd541961da3e9b7a6d26528882da49d61503bca0eb45f17c6756208:0

value
65343958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 432ff985fc8b5014dadfedcc6449f17348f6ae05 OP_EQUAL
address
ME2Qyd7c53CF4LFKixStVTL5JJkDYymm4g
transaction
8c566eb2fdd541961da3e9b7a6d26528882da49d61503bca0eb45f17c6756208
spent
true